G m9/B

The G m9 chord consists of the G (Perfect unison), A# (Minor third), D (Perfect fifth), F (Minor seventh) and A (Major ninth) notes, with B as the bass note.

Piano keyboard showing the notes for a G m9/B chord

How to play the G m9/B chord

  1. Play B as the lowest bass note in the left hand
  2. Find G (Root) on the piano keyboard
  3. Add A# (Minor third) — 3 semitones above G
  4. Add D (Perfect fifth) — 7 semitones above G
  5. Add F (Minor seventh) — 10 semitones above G
  6. Add A (Major ninth) — 14 semitones above G
  7. Press all 6 notes simultaneously to sound the G m9/B chord
